Boston, MA (PRWEB) September 18, 2013 -- A new report and video from Health News Wires titled Simple Changes in Family’s Routine Reduces Obesity in Children details how small changes in the time spent watching television and sleeping result in reduced weight gain and obesity risk in children.
New research from the Massachusetts General Hospital for Children indicates that reducing time spent in front of the television and increasing a child’s sleep time result in reducing the risk of weight gain and becoming obese.
Children aged 2 to 5 either maintained their normal household routines or reduced television watching by an hour and increased sleep time by 45 minutes a day. At the conclusion of the study researchers observed a slower, more appropriate weight gain and reduced Body Mass Index in the group increasing sleep and decreasing time spent watching television.
In addition to reducing television time and increasing sleep time, families were also provided maps to local playgrounds, parks, and outdoor recreation areas. Researches also provided information to parents about childhood nutrition and alternative activities to television watching.
